Took this in the spring. This was a barn I'd always said I'd paint if I knew how -- then I got my camera. :) When I'd had it about a month and a half I was on my way home from a doctor's appointment, having just had surgery two weeks before, and I told my husband I wanted to photograph the barn on the way home. I ended up walking about a quarter of a mile in a great deal of pain to get this shot. I don't expect it to do well in a challenge this monstrous, but that's no reason not to enter. :)

Post-processing: Straighten, crop, levels, contrast, duotone sepia workaround, saturation, resize, cloned out a gate.
